摘要
Under the global trend of modern quality education, the set of higher educational scholarship is aimed to reward the students who work hard both inside and outside class activities and achieve great success in kinds of academic competitions. At this time, with great emphasis by governments and outstanding construction on the educational infrastructure, the number of students in universities has been increasing dramatically. Meanwhile, during the development of the education in such a long period, universities generally accumulate a huge amount of the information concerned with the students. What the administrators always do to handle such information are merely storing, querying and doing some other basic manipulations instead of making full use of these data. For example, those manual evaluations of the educational scholarship always revolve around the rank of scholarship and the number of the students who are rewarded rather than analyzing the facts which can influence the achieving of the scholarship. As a result, the evaluation is apparently lack of fairness and efficiency. In this paper, based on C4.5 decision tree, a higher educational scholarship evaluation model is built. By using such algorithm, an efficient and fair scholarship evaluation system can be realized. (C) 2019 The Authors. Published by Elsevier B.V.
